ajax加载页面(ajax请求页面)
本文目录一览:
如何实现分页如何实现ajax分页.使用ajax实现页面分页
maxentries:总条目数(必填,整数) items_per_page:每页显示条数(可选,默认10) num_display_entries:主体部分显示的页数(可选,默认10) current_page:当前页(可选,默认1) 其他自定义文本和按钮设置 代码示例 前台代码:这部分实现了一致的分页样式和交互,适用于前端展示。
ajax请求后台拿到json类型的数据后,可以在它的success回调方法中进行动态分页,也就是表格重绘,此时,我们需要得到的数据包括:查询得到的数据、数据总条数、总页数、当前页数,其中前三条可在后台获取,对于当前页数,需要从前端获取点击页数再通过请求传递给后台,后台做完相应处理后再传回给前端。
用隐藏域。每一页的选择项都记下来,提交到下一页的时候把记下来的选择项用隐藏域把它放到第二页里,第二页选择的项累加记录,一起传到下一页。如此累推。用session记录。每一页提交后,把提交的选择项放到session的一个变量里,下一页再提交,累加存到那个变量里。
怎么用ajax加载一个页面的内容到另一个页面
两个页面中是可以使用ajax传值的,你可以使用a.html?id=1的方式来传,但是在页面里用javascript取的时候要费些劲,可以上网查一下,如果找不到可以找我,我给你发一份。楼上的这些朋友回答也是个比较简单的解决办法。但不是最终解决方案。
普通的ajax是不允许跨域操作的,所以只有一条路可以走那就是jsonp格式交互。如果不是同域名下就用jsonp。
没看你的代码,我一般都用JQuery的ajax框架做ajax。给你一个我的思路,我用的asp.net语言。文件需求:一个显示调用页面,命名为a。aspx;一个ajax后台返回数据页,命名为ajax。
要是一个页面上输入数字,另一个不同页面生成柱状图的话,用一种高级AJAX技术,叫Comet,就可实现,Comet比传统Ajax更优越的地方在于传统Ajax是从页面想服务器请求数据,而Comet是一种服务器向页面推送数据的技术。你可以想象一下一些股票报价图,和体育比赛直播的页面。
ajax获取数据后怎么去渲染到页面
1、最简单的方法就是,参数传至另外一个Jsp页面时直接将值赋给一个隐藏的文本框,然后JS获取就行了。通过ajax读取到写好的jsp,另一个jsp可以放framse或者层都可以,显示就行了。用ajax获取到后台数据,然后拼接到html内容中就可以了,原生AJAX比较复杂,可以用jQuery的ajax。
2、新建一个html文件,命名为test.html。在test.html中,使用script标签加载jquery.min.js文件,这是使用jquery方法的前提。在test.html页面中,创建一个button按钮,用于实现点击通过ajax请求获得json数据,在button下面再创建一个p元素,用于json数据的显示。
3、打开HBuilderX工具,创建Web项目,新建静态页面ajax.html。打开已新建的ajax.html文件,引入jquery文件并修改title标签内容。在标签中,插入一个div标签,并在div标签中插入一个table。接着在项目中的data文件夹下,新建user.json文件。打开user.json文件,添加json格式数据。
4、通过this.state或者this.props渲染数据。把Ajax写在componentDidMount里,当react-router决定好哪个组件来渲染页面,在这个组件第一次渲染的时候加载Ajax取得数据再通过this.state或者this.props渲染数据。
5、文章的内容是使用bootstrap-paginator进行分页,使用ajax获取后台数据、渲染。版本说明bootstrap2bootstrap-paginatorv0github准备工程建立动态web工程,新建index.html页面,引入bootstrap相关cssjs文件。
6、其实也很简单的,你重新再调用一次highcharts渲染一次就可以了。代码我就不写了,我说一下大致流程:使用ajax异步获取相关数据;重新调用$(#container_custom_default).highcharts(...)就可以了,调用的时候把你的数据放在对应你原本使用php输出的地方。
ajax的作用?啥时候使用ajax呢?
AJAX的主要作用是在不重新加载整个网页的情况下,更新网页的某些部分。 使用AJAX可以提高用户体验,因为它允许页面某些内容的更新,而无需重新提交整个表单或刷新整个页面。 当需要改变页面上的数据区域,且不希望用户失去当前的输入数据或选择时,AJAX尤为有用。
作用:高效率的实现页面和web服务器之间数据的异步传输。采用ajax的页面,可以实现页面的局部更新,不需要整个页面更新,同时用户可以进行页面的其他操作,这是异步的方式,效率比较高。不采用ajax的页面,当用户在页面发起请求时,要进行整个页面的刷新,刷新快慢取决于服务器的处理快慢。
AJAX = 异步 JavaScript和XML(标准通用标记语言的子集)。通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新。这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。
AJAX 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术。详细解释: AJAX 的定义 AJAX是一种用于创建动态交互性网页的技术。它通过使浏览器与服务器进行少量的数据交换,可以在不刷新整个页面的情况下,实现对网页的局部更新。这样,用户可以更加流畅地浏览网页,获得更好的体验。
发表评论
暂时没有评论,来抢沙发吧~